WebA running head is a heading printed at the top of each page of a document or book. Most fiction makes use of a running head, usually the title of the work. An MLA running head consists of the student’s last name and a page number. This information is typed in the header area of the page and aligned flush right. See the sample on page 4. How many lines are included in a MLA header (this is where the page number is located)? A. WebIn general, that means that papers will. Have a one inch margin on all sides. Use 12 pt. Times New Roman font. Be double-spaced. Contain a heading at the top left containing the student’s name, professor’s name, class name, and the date. Contain a unique title centered on the first page.
